Spring School for Care Experienced Students
We are excited to invite care-experienced young people to apply for Spring School 2026! Spring School is hosted across the Canterbury campuses of the University of Kent, Canterbury Christchurch University and the University for the Creative Arts and is free to attend. Students aged 14-19 are introduced to what it means to be a university student, offering a hands-on, interactive experience of life at university.

From Care to Campus Videos
See how to navigate university through the eyes of care experienced students. In partnership with the University of Kent and Kent and Medway Progression Federation, this video is part of a series of three, aiming to shed light on the pressing questions care experienced young people may have when thinking about higher education:
-
- Where will I live?
- How can I afford it?
- What is university like for care experienced students?
Working in collaboration with those with living experience of care, these videos highlight their personal journeys and invaluable insights.
